Drawing silence down on
wings of indigo black,
night descends upon hearts,
dreaming delights,drenched by
autumn sunshine to come.
As gold, leaf and
love remain eternal,third
season bellows flame hues,
smouldering through long winter
nights,cold carpets clean
with snow, union confirmed.
Facing fresh future winds,
like clouds flying free.
